Banking, finance and capital markets (Tier 3)
Emmanuel Dryllerakis leads the practice at Dryllerakis & Associates, which specialises in complex bond loans, NPL transactions, and matters relating to virtual and fiat currencies. As a member of the TerraLex network of international law firms, the firm is also able to advise on multi-jurisdictional matters. Dryllerakis is described by clients as an 'excellent business partner' and has extensive experience of advising on privatisations, restructurings, and corporate and project finance.

Dispute resolution (Tier 1)
Dryllerakis & Associates has ‘longstanding experience before all Greek courts‘, representing clients in both private enforcement actions before the civil courts and public enforcement actions before the administrative courts. The team also has broad expertise in both domestic and international arbitration. Of counsel John Damilakis co-heads the practice and has particular expertise in disputes relating to investment incentives and privatisations. Gerassimos Apergis and Vassilis Constantinidis also head the practice, with specialist knowledge encompassing competition, fraud, employment and IP litigation. Counsel Maria Stoumpidi strengthens the team with her expertise in planning, zoning and environmental litigation; senior managing partner John Dryllerakis is also noted for his 50-year-long experience representing clients before the Supreme Court; and Panagiotis Kakaletris is another key contact.

EU and competition (Tier 1)
Dryllerakis & Associates‘ team has significant experience of handling cases before the Hellenic Competition Commission, overseeing cartel and abuse of dominance matters; it has recently represented Attica Bank in the HCC’s investigation into alleged anti-competitive agreements, advising on each stage of the investigation, including the dawn raid and procedural steps. The firm is also active in state aid matters, with the work encompassing preliminary and formal EC investigations, as well as representation before the EU courts and national court proceedings in relation to the recovery of incompatible state aid. The practice is led by Emmanuel Dryllerakis, who is leading the firm’s advice to Unilever on a case concerning alleged abuse of dominance and anti-competitive agreements in the market for margarine products. John Dryllerakis and Cleomenis Yannikas are also notable contacts.

Tax (Tier 1)
Dryllerakis & Associates provides a comprehensive range of services to clients on tax matters, with its specialist team handling the full spectrum of matters, including tax planning, litigation, accounting law and transfer pricing. The practice is led by John Dryllerakis, who has substantial experience of advising on international financial transactions. Reflective of the growth of the practice, Nikolaia-Anna Lepida made partner, while John Papadakis and Dimitris Karavas were promoted to senior asssociate in 2021. Recent work included advising Eurobank S.A. and Eurobank Equities S.A on a claim against the Greek State over unduly paid taxes. Eleftherios Rantos is another name to note.
